TOSA Reference model 0.90.0 Release Notes

Add support for the TOSA shape operators
Support the new RESCALE signedness attributes
Compliance generator fixes
Significant improvement in Main Inference conformance coverage
Save int8/uint8 outputs as the native type instead of int32
Removed the operator API
Many cleanups and bug fixes
  1. 2226f90 Extend pad tests to include quantized type and explicit pad value. by TatWai Chong · 1 year, 4 months ago
  2. 681e0a8 Create MI tests for Tensors: TRANSPOSE_CONV2D by James Ward · 1 year, 4 months ago
  3. 30124a8 Bug fixes for max-batch-size/ofm-depth by James Ward · 1 year, 5 months ago
  4. c5d7593 Create MI tests for Tensor: FFT2D & RFFT2D by Jeremy Johnson · 1 year, 4 months ago
  5. ae7a81c Create MI tests for Tensor: CONV3D by Jeremy Johnson · 1 year, 5 months ago
  6. ae25b93 Create MI tests for Tensors: DEPTHWISE_CONV2D by James Ward · 1 year, 5 months ago
  7. 6587242 Add tests for INT48 CONST support by Luke Hutton · 1 year, 4 months ago
  8. 6013685 Select new TFLite SPLIT tests by Jeremy Johnson · 1 year, 5 months ago
  9. 5728713 Add FFT2d to the reference model by Luke Hutton · 1 year, 5 months ago
  10. dd3e9aa Adjust ERROR_IF tests generated for tosa-mi profile by Jeremy Johnson · 1 year, 5 months ago
  11. 8384a6f Create MI tests for Tensors: AVG_POOL2D, FULLY_CONNECTED, MATMUL by James Ward · 1 year, 5 months ago
  12. 9165b9a Create MI tests for Tensor: CONV2D by Jeremy Johnson · 1 year, 5 months ago
  13. d34b3fc Remove accumulator attributes from all but AVG_POOL2D by James Ward · 1 year, 5 months ago
  14. 512c1ca Create MI tests for Reduction: REDUCE_SUM, REDUCE_PRODUCT by James Ward · 1 year, 5 months ago
  15. 736fd1a Create MI tests for Type Conversion: CAST by James Ward · 1 year, 5 months ago
  16. 2138a19 Add framework tests for tfl.atan2 by Luke Hutton · 1 year, 6 months ago
  17. 5c84421 Add RFFT2d to optimized only kernel list by Luke Hutton · 1 year, 5 months ago
  18. d713a4d Add framework test for math.sign by TatWai Chong · 1 year, 8 months ago
  19. fac5c31 Create MI tests for Comparison: EQUAL, GREATER, GREATER_EQUAL by Jeremy Johnson · 1 year, 5 months ago
  20. 35396f2 Create MI tests for EW Unary: LOG, RECIPROCAL, RSQRT, EXP by Jeremy Johnson · 1 year, 6 months ago
  21. 261b7b6 Add RFFT2d to the reference model by Luke Hutton · 1 year, 6 months ago
  22. c253e64 Create MI tests for Data Layout: SLICE by James Ward · 1 year, 5 months ago
  23. 3407125 Create MI tests for Activation: CLAMP; Data Layout: PAD by James Ward · 1 year, 7 months ago
  24. 657af86 Add framework tests for tf.sin and tf.cos by Luke Hutton · 1 year, 6 months ago
  25. 9e94af8 Reference model update for control flow operators support by Jerry Ge · 1 year, 8 months ago
  26. dd8d9c2 Create MI tests for EW Binary: ADD, SUB, MUL by Jeremy Johnson · 1 year, 6 months ago
  27. 6ffb7c8 Create MI tests for EW Binary: POW by Jeremy Johnson · 1 year, 7 months ago
  28. 05c711e Add extra control flow ERROR_IF tests by Jeremy Johnson · 1 year, 6 months ago
  29. 7f1ea8e Create MI tests for Image: RESIZE by James Ward · 1 year, 6 months ago
  30. b45db9a Create MI tests for Activation: SIGMOID, TANH by James Ward · 1 year, 6 months ago
  31. 2a27c8f Create MI tests for EW Ternary: SELECT by James Ward · 1 year, 7 months ago
  32. 71616fe Create MI tests for EW Unary: ABS, CEIL, FLOOR, NEGATE by James Ward · 1 year, 7 months ago
  33. 635bc99 Create MI tests for Reduction: REDUCE_MIN, REDUCE_MAX by James Ward · 1 year, 7 months ago
  34. b9c3a63 Create MI tests for EW Binary: MINIMUM, MAXIMUM by James Ward · 1 year, 7 months ago
  35. 4160186 Add framework tests for tfl.sin and tfl.cos by Luke Hutton · 1 year, 7 months ago
  36. d88c3b3 Fix conformance desc.json contains correct profiles by Jeremy Johnson · 1 year, 7 months ago
  37. 542dd3b Create MI tests for Data Nodes: CONST, IDENTITY by James Ward · 1 year, 7 months ago
  38. f089099 Create MI tests for Data Layout: CONCAT, PAD, RESHAPE, REVERSE, SLICE, TILE, TRANSPOSE by James Ward · 1 year, 7 months ago
  39. 990cc4b Create MI tests for Scatter/Gather: SCATTER, GATHER by James Ward · 1 year, 7 months ago
  40. 52ac9d6 Create MI tests for Tensors: ARGMAX, MAX_POOL2D by James Ward · 1 year, 7 months ago
  41. e4b08ff Initial set up of Main Inference conformance test gen by Jeremy Johnson · 1 year, 9 months ago
  42. 41a04fe Add framework test for tfl.prelu by TatWai Chong · 1 year, 8 months ago
  43. 24dbc42 Add BF16 support to reference model by James Ward · 1 year, 8 months ago
  44. 3b0544c Add TILE bool tests & rename CAST/RESCALE tests by Jeremy Johnson · 1 year, 8 months ago
  45. bc2a3db Rename FLOAT type to FP32 by Jeremy Johnson · 1 year, 9 months ago
  46. 93d4390 Minor fixes & add FP16 support to refmodel testing and conformance gen by Jeremy Johnson · 1 year, 9 months ago
  47. 8b39043 Reference model changes for fp16 support by James Ward · 1 year, 11 months ago
  48. a0848c6 Add CONST testing to Numpy refmodel tests by Jeremy Johnson · 1 year, 9 months ago
  49. f7008da Add framework test for TF and TFL mirrorpad by TatWai Chong · 1 year, 10 months ago
  50. 0042343 Add simple post commit reference model testing against Numpy by Jeremy Johnson · 1 year, 10 months ago
  51. d4fe4bf Update RESCALE testing to match no rank restrictions by Eric Kunze · 1 year, 10 months ago
  52. 5a76b2a [Fix] Wrong dimension is inferred in tensor shape generation by TatWai Chong · 1 year, 10 months ago
  53. fd62905 Update framework test generator to support TF/TFL conv3d. by TatWai Chong · 1 year, 11 months ago
  54. c1a9783 Align padding for transpose_conv2d to match spec by Eric Kunze · 2 years ago
  55. 473eb38 Add generator functions to support TFL gelu by TatWai Chong · 1 year, 11 months ago
  56. d32c6da Add PAD ERROR_IF test for output shape by Jeremy Johnson · 1 year, 10 months ago
  57. d511f9e Enabled 16-bit TABLE REQUIRE statement by Jerry Ge · 1 year, 11 months ago
  58. 286f834 Simplify the argument parsing and debug code by Eric Kunze · 2 years ago
  59. a0e03f3 Update RESIZE operator in test generator for spec updates by Jeremy Johnson · 2 years ago
  60. f732609 Update TOSA resize to match specification by TatWai Chong · 2 years, 1 month ago
  61. 9391243 Added framework tests for Relu1 Operator legalization by Jerry Ge · 1 year, 11 months ago
  62. 8858862 Add profile to all created conformance tests. by Jeremy Johnson · 2 years ago
  63. 0ecfa37 Add conformance generator scripts by Jeremy Johnson · 2 years ago
  64. 750d27d Modify input limits for apply_scale_32 by Eric Kunze · 2 years ago
  65. b5fabec Remove quantization info from serialization attributes by Eric Kunze · 2 years, 1 month ago
  66. 24594f5 Update transpose_conv2d to align with TOSA spec by TatWai Chong · 2 years, 1 month ago
  67. c23fc3b Remove RESHAPE -1 dimensions support by Jeremy Johnson · 2 years, 1 month ago
  68. f7f78ae Add support for uint16_t to RESCALE by Jeremy Johnson · 2 years, 1 month ago
  69. 0e6218e Update framework test generation for ERROR_IF criteria by Jeremy Johnson · 2 years, 2 months ago
  70. 0e46364 Fix for NEGATE using 32-bit accumulator by Jeremy Johnson · 2 years, 2 months ago
  71. 5860df6 Control oversized tests for TRANSPOSE_CONV2D by Jeremy Johnson · 2 years, 2 months ago
  72. 4a6fb9b Update tensor ops ERROR_IF criteria by Jeremy Johnson · 2 years, 2 months ago
  73. 9a66abb Refactor verif/generator/tosa_test_gen.py into different files by Jeremy Johnson · 2 years, 3 months ago
  74. 7bebea8 Fix NEGATE int8 test value ranges by Jeremy Johnson · 2 years, 3 months ago
  75. 7de9b45 Add missing REQUIREs check to REDUCE_SUM in refmodel by Jeremy Johnson · 2 years, 3 months ago
  76. 5d1a347 Update pre-commit tool versions by Jeremy Johnson · 2 years, 3 months ago
  77. 81ee53d Add missing REQUIRE to NEGATE op by Jeremy Johnson · 2 years, 3 months ago
  78. 25669b3 Improve EQUAL tests to have matching numbers by Jeremy Johnson · 2 years, 3 months ago
  79. b7af461 Fix input rank-match comparison, --no-ref-model flag, no test list by Jared Smolens · 2 years, 3 months ago
  80. 8a8cca9 Generate REDUCE_MIN tests (instead of REDUCE_MAX) by Jeremy Johnson · 2 years, 3 months ago
  81. 015c355 Add framework unit test generation scripts by Jeremy Johnson · 2 years, 4 months ago
  82. c0fe04d Fix rescale test gen for scale32 & dtype by Jeremy Johnson · 2 years, 4 months ago
  83. 42c9bae Update refmodel apply_scale_32: adjust range checking by Jeremy Johnson · 2 years, 5 months ago
  84. ae0c1c6 Minor formatting fixes for python by Jeremy Johnson · 2 years, 4 months ago
  85. 39f127b Fix for max arguments to be respected in build tests by Jeremy Johnson · 2 years, 5 months ago
  86. 0c171ac Fix COND_IF binary INT8/16 test generation by Jeremy Johnson · 2 years, 5 months ago
  87. 66bad80 Fix for LOGICAL_LEFT/RIGHT_SHIFT shift values by Jeremy Johnson · 2 years, 5 months ago
  88. 5c1364c Add python pre-commit script checkers by Jeremy Johnson · 2 years, 5 months ago
  89. be1a940 Update tosa_verif_run_ref by Jeremy Johnson · 2 years, 6 months ago
  90. 2ec3494 Reorganize verif and create packages by Jeremy Johnson · 2 years, 6 months ago
  91. a1d4985 Fix crash with rank mismatch negative tests by Eric Kunze · 2 years, 6 months ago
  92. f20a5a4 Stop COND_IF neg tests creating bad arrays by Jeremy Johnson · 2 years, 7 months ago
  93. 729b035 Do not generate tests that fail validation checks by Les Bell · 2 years, 7 months ago
  94. 3ca02a7 WrongRank negative test gen additions & fixes by Jeremy Johnson · 2 years, 7 months ago
  95. 27cf543 ERRORIF test generation fixes by Jeremy Johnson · 2 years, 7 months ago
  96. 0e027d4 Convolutions ERROR_IF tests by Les Bell · 2 years, 8 months ago
  97. 7e9ac9a Add Broadcast DimensionMismatch errors by Jeremy Johnson · 2 years, 8 months ago
  98. 01c359d Fix Transpose WrongRank test and add new test for Concat by Matthew Haddon · 2 years, 8 months ago
  99. 630c17c Add negative testing to cond_if, while_loop by Matthew Haddon · 2 years, 8 months ago
  100. bb5676f Add ERROR_IF checks to operators without specific ERROR_IFs by Matthew Haddon · 2 years, 8 months ago